Output 396c630aad80607c0a81f16aedfb95f6688bb1e32eef773b1260818fcb26dd8e:1

value
1380806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c11411a71cd2bb994fa00043573b4ab0826702 OP_EQUAL
address
3AEk4huGZHtKTeTvNy4sBXhSBb2A6RCAkx
transaction
396c630aad80607c0a81f16aedfb95f6688bb1e32eef773b1260818fcb26dd8e
spent
true